  • Costs of buying parts from the EU

    Just wondering if anybody knows if buying a clutch kit for example from SACHS will now incur any additional fees?

    On the site it mentions that 19% VAT is included in the price, but would that be deducted and the 20% UK VAT collected after purchase ? + any additional import costs?

    OR will i have to pay 19% EU vat AND 20% uk vat on top?

    I am on the other side of this, where I now have to pay EU tax on items from the UK. So I am not an expert on buying EU items into the UK.

    But....

    You will need to pay UK VAT and possibly an import duty. Then it will be upto the seller to refund you the EU tax back. It will probably be worth speaking to them before hand rather than presuming that you can claim it back.
